I'm having problems trying to get the syntax right for getting the sample_multi_transcode.exe sample to do composition - i.e.using the -vpp_ command line options in the par file. Everything I've tried so far seems to give syntax error messages.
Do you have a working example par file for sample_multi_transcode.exe that successfully composes two h264 input files to a single h264 output file (or similar) ?

Hi Iroeville,
Try to write the following strings in .par file:
-i::h264 input1.264 -vpp_comp_dst_y 0 -n 300 -vpp_comp_dst_h 135 -vpp_comp_dst_x 0 -join -vpp_comp_dst_w 480 -hw -f 30 -o::sink
-i::h264 input2.264 -vpp_comp_dst_y 0 -n 300 -vpp_comp_dst_h 135 -vpp_comp_dst_x 480 -join -vpp_comp_dst_w 480 -hw -f 30 -o::sink
-i::source -h 1080 -b 8700 -w 1920 -join -async 1 -hw -n 300 -fe 30 -vpp_comp 2 -l 1 -o::h264 output.h264

Thanks Anna. I tried this with the pre-built sample_multi_transcode.exe and a couple of 1920x1088 sized h264 files that are 234 frames in length, so slightly changed values like this:
-i::h264 f1.h264 -vpp_comp_dst_y 0 -n 234 -vpp_comp_dst_h 135 -vpp_comp_dst_x 0 -join -vpp_comp_dst_w 480 -hw -f 30 -o::sink
-i::h264 f1a.h264 -vpp_comp_dst_y 0 -n 234 -vpp_comp_dst_h 135 -vpp_comp_dst_x 480 -join -vpp_comp_dst_w 480 -hw -f 30 -o::sink
-i::source -h 1088 -b 8700 -w 1920 -join -async 1 -hw -n 234 -fe 30 -vpp_comp 2 -l 1 -o::h264 output.h264
It seems to process OK with this transcript:

The output.h264 file seems to be identified OK in MediaInfo - but VLC will not play it although it will play the input h264 files.
Any idea what is wrong?

According to command line output transcoding is correct. I'm not clear does VNC work with raw video. Usually players work with video in containers. I reproduced the scenario and Windows Media Player plays the output fine. Also sample_decode can render it well.
